问题标签 [receive-location]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
1612 浏览

biztalk - Biztalk - 我可以更改现有接收位置的接收端口吗?

我有两个不同的接收端口和两个接收位置 - 每个端口分配一个位置。端口设置为接收完全相同类型的文件 - 我最终得到了两者,因为我合并了两个执行相同操作的不同应用程序。

我想将这两个位置合并到一个接收端口中,但我似乎无法更改其中一个位置所属的位置 - 我找不到这样做的选项。本质上,我只想取一个位置(或者 - 我不在乎),并将其分配给另一个端口,这样一个端口有两个位置,另一个没有。

有人知道更改现有位置的接收端口的方法吗?

0 投票
1 回答
2261 浏览

biztalk - Biztalk - 处理平面文件收到“未找到订阅者”消息

我已经从我拥有的 CSV 文件实例在 Visual Studio 中创建了一个平面文件架构,并且它验证得很好,并且我已经连接了一个编排来发送和接收设置为期望该架构文件的端口。当我发布编排并使用它来获取文件时,它立即被挂起,并出现以下错误:

无法路由已发布的消息,因为未找到订阅者。如果尚未征用订阅编排或发送端口,或者未提升订阅评估所需的某些消息属性,则会发生此错误。请使用 Biztalk 管理控制台解决此故障。

发送端口已登记,由于我没有根据内容进行任何处理,我认为我不需要宣传任何东西。我目前正在使用 PassthroughReceive 管道-其他三个管道我给了我关于无法反汇编文件的错误,因为它们似乎在期待 XML。

我在这里遗漏了一些明显的东西吗?或者,换句话说:

我可以在没有自定义管道的情况下将 CSV 文件的内容传递给我的编排吗?

0 投票
2 回答
964 浏览

biztalk - 在 Biztalk 中复制接收位置

我有一个 Biztalk 应用程序,它需要大约十几个几乎完全相同的接收位置(一个属性,远程 FTP 站点上的文件夹,它们之间是不同的)。理想情况下,我想取一个我已经创建的位置,并让 Biztalk 复制它很多次,然后我将编辑每个副本的属性,使其正确。

有没有一种简单的方法来复制现有的接收位置,或者我必须手动创建所有十几个位置?

0 投票
1 回答
192 浏览

http - 使用不同的接收位置创建不同的编排

我需要有两个从 HTTP 接收端口获取相同输入模式消息的编排。

编排做不同的事情。

我不明白我怎么能调用一个编排或另一个。

我脑子里只有一个解决方案,但我认为它不正确。

我创建了两个不同的接收位置。一个编排 -> 一个接收位置..

它看起来像正确的解决方案。但是创建一个接收位置意味着在我的 IIS 上的 http 站点中创建一个虚拟文件夹,其中包含BTSHTTPReceive.dll.

所以我的疑问是:如果我有 20 个具有相同输入的编排,我应该创建 20 个包含 DLL 的虚拟文件夹吗?

这看起来是一个可怕的解决方案。

解决我的问题的正确方法是什么?

0 投票
2 回答
399 浏览

biztalk - BizTalk 2010 确定接收位置的主机限制设置

由于所需的管道组件似乎无法访问数据库以获取消息的详细信息,因此我计划使用主机限制来限制 BizTalk 在接收位置处理的文件数量。我希望能够指示应在 Y 秒(或任何其他可行的时间跨度)内处理 X 条消息。有谁知道可以使用哪些限制设置来强制这种行为?

我知道如何设置值,但是我找不到最佳配置。

(注意:其中一种解决方案也可能会调整管道,但它包含无法调整的第三方组件。)

0 投票
1 回答
499 浏览

biztalk - 启用 - 在 BizTalk 中禁用端口历史记录

我正在使用 BizTalk 2010。

我想搜索接收位置或发送端口的历史记录,以查看它们何时启用以及何时禁用。我有权访问 BizTalk 数据库来运行查询。如果我也能看到他们被禁用的原因,那就太好了。

0 投票
1 回答
247 浏览

sql - BizTalk WCF-SQL 接收位置通知回调返回错误

我试图让 SQL 通知与 BizTalk 一起工作,但我正在苦苦挣扎。

Receivelocation的绑定如下:

在此处输入图像描述

SQL Server 支持通知,连接字符串正确。

当我启动 Receivelocation 时,它以正确的方式运行一次,但是当我禁用它并再次启动它时,我在事件日志中收到以下错误。

  • 消息引擎无法将 URL 为“mssql://.//Database?InboundId=GetNewMDMChanges”的接收位置“RL.MDM.SQL”添加到适配器“WCF-SQL”。原因:“Microsoft.ServiceModel.Channels.Common.TargetSystemException:通知回调返回错误。Info=Invalid。Source=Statement。Type=Subscribe。

在我在数据库上执行以下命令以启用代理之前,我无法再次启动接收位置。

这里奇怪的是,当我在执行上面的命令之前检查代理是否仍然启用时,我看到代理确实仍然启用。

因此,启用代理的命令正好解决了我的另一个通知问题,而我必须再次执行此操作。

有没有人遇到过这个问题或者可以告诉我我做错了什么?提前致谢。

0 投票
1 回答
303 浏览

biztalk - 具有空成员的 Biztalk 多部分消息

我创建了一个 POP3 接收位置,它将电子邮件发送到一个业务流程。我为此使用的消息是多部分消息,一部分用于附件,第二部分用于正文。当我发送带有附件的电子邮件时,一切正常。但是,当我发送一封没有附件的电子邮件时,甚至在我处理邮件之前,我就会收到一个异常:

暂停消息中的消息当然包含一部分(仅正文),因为没有附件。

有没有办法处理它或过滤编排中的接收组件?

0 投票
1 回答
443 浏览

import - 尽管绑定文件中的“启用”属性等于 true,但 BizTalk“接收位置”状态仍处于禁用状态

我从“BizTalk Server 管理控制台”->“导入-> 绑定...”导入了示例绑定文件。

它成功创建了接收位置,但尽管在文件<Enable>true</Enable>中,它创建了状态为禁用的位置。

是否可以通过绑定文件启用它?

0 投票
1 回答
491 浏览

biztalk - POP3 接收位置无法连接到邮件服务器

我在 biztalk 服务器控制台中添加了一个接收位置,我收到警告说它没有连接。

我已经检查了 biztalk 外部的连接并且它正在工作。基于此,问题必须与 biztalk 控制台定义或属性有关,而不是与邮件服务器或机器有关。

是否有一些定义可以为 biztalk 控制台启用传出端口或类似的东西可以解决问题?

测试连接:

连接成功:

用户名和密码正确:

位置设置:

警告我得到: